My Students

My students attend a pre-kindergarten through fifth grade elementary school in New York City. Our school is located in an area of the South Bronx with a very high concentration of poverty.

Most, if not all, of my students are eligible for free lunch.

They are a hard working group of first graders who are persistent, and determined to do well in school. They are a group of hard workers who need essential resources to help them do their best.

My Project

Tell me what you eat, and I will tell you who you are." ~ Jean Anthelme Brillant-Savarin

My students are a curious and energetic group of fourth graders who seem to become more focused and inspired after recess when they are giving healthier snacking options.

They attend a Title I elementary school in New York City. Our school is located in the South Bronx - in an area with a very high concentration of poverty. Most, if not all, of my students qualify for free or reduced-price lunch.

My students are becoming more conscious of their bodies and what they are putting inside of them. When asked what items they would like to have to create their own trail mixes, they said, "sunflower seeds, raisins, fruit, and nuts". They understand how important snacking is and say they want healthier items to "boost their brain power." Many say that it is often harder to concentrate when they are hungry and just need a little snack to do their best thinking when schools are closed during holiday breaks, or on weekend.They say that having a healthier selection of items to choose from would expose them to new foods and inspire them to eat healthier. Your generous donations to this project will provide my students with creative options for healthy snacks that they can take home and enjoy. These healthy snacks will help them develop stronger bodies and provide essential nutrients that boost brain power, too!

They say that they would prefer making and eating trail mixes over potato chips, candy bars and sugary drinks.
